Booker, Wyden, Clarke Introduce Bicameral Bill to Regulate Use of Artificial Intelligence to Make Critical Decisions like Housing, Employment and Education

Press Release

Date: Sept. 21, 2023
Location: Washington, D.C.

"As the use of AI and algorithmic decision making becomes more prevalent--particularly by companies that make critical decisions about Americans' health, finances, housing, and educational opportunities--we must ensure that there are sufficient regulations and standards in place to protect people from bias and discrimination. I am glad to cosponsor the Algorithmic Accountability Act to strengthen consumer protections and increase accountability for companies using algorithms to make decisions."
